mango - a man-page generator for the flag, pflag, and cobra packages
I think name collision is something we're just gonna have to live with. There's also https://github.com/paulbellamy/mango but it seems like less of a problem with go since the import path contains the github username and you can always specify a different local name if two "mango" packages are needed in the same file
